15 lines
447 B
JavaScript
15 lines
447 B
JavaScript
import {defineConfig} from 'drizzle-kit'
|
|
|
|
if(!process.env.DATABASE_HOST){
|
|
throw new Error('Data base info missing ')
|
|
}
|
|
|
|
const dbURL = `postgres://${process.env.DATABASE_USER}:${process.env.DATABASE_PASSWORD}@${process.env.DATABASE_HOST}:${process.env.DATABASE_PORT}/${process.env.DATABASE_DB}`;
|
|
|
|
export default defineConfig({
|
|
dialect:'postgresql',
|
|
schema: "./src/db/schema",
|
|
out: './migrations',
|
|
dbCredentials: {url: dbURL}
|
|
})
|